Sony is expected to introduce the high-end Xperia Z3+ in India this week, but it appears the company is also testing a number of new devices as well.
Recently, four new Sony smartphones were imported to India for testing and debugging purposes, carrying a high price tag of INR 39,239 hinting at the fact that these are high-end devices.
These are not the final products but just prototypes namely, Seahawk Rex PQ, Eagle Rex AP, Seahawk Gina AP, and the Eagle Rilads AP. These aren’t the real names of the devices, but appears to be codenames for some of the upcoming devices from the Japanese manufacturer.
The details about what the handsets will come with are quite scarce at the moment, but the thing is, some high-end devices from Sony may soon hit the market. Plus the pricing mentioned on Zauba isn’t the final one, the retail price will be quite higher than the one listed on the imports tracking website.
